Elucidating the specific pharmacological mechanism of action (MOA) of naturally developing compounds might be challenging. Despite the fact that Tarselli et al. (sixty) created the initial de novo artificial pathway to conolidine and showcased this naturally happening compound efficiently suppresses responses to both chemically induced and inflammation-derived pain, the pharmacologic goal to blame for its antinociceptive motion remained elusive. Offered the problems involved with standard pharmacological and physiological methods, Mendis et al. utilized cultured neuronal networks grown on multi-electrode array (MEA) technological innovation coupled with sample matching reaction profiles to offer a possible MOA of conolidine (sixty one). A comparison of drug consequences within the MEA cultures of central anxious technique Energetic compounds determined the response profile of conolidine was most similar to that of ω-conotoxin CVIE, a Cav2.

Though the opiate receptor depends on G protein coupling for signal transduction, this receptor was identified to employ arrestin activation for internalization with the receptor. Otherwise, the receptor promoted no other signaling cascades (fifty nine) Modifications of conolidine have resulted in variable enhancement in binding efficacy. This binding eventually greater endogenous opioid peptide concentrations, expanding binding to opiate receptors along with the affiliated pain reduction.

Most lately, it has been determined that conolidine and the above mentioned derivatives act within the atypical chemokine receptor 3 (ACKR3. Expressed in identical places as classical opioid receptors, it binds to your big range of endogenous opioids. In contrast to most opioid receptors, this receptor acts being a scavenger and does not activate a second messenger technique (fifty nine). As talked about by Meyrath et al., this also indicated a doable connection in between these receptors along with the endogenous opiate process (fifty nine). This examine in the long run decided the ACKR3 receptor did not generate any G protein signal reaction by measuring and finding no mini G protein interactions, in contrast to classical opiate receptors, which recruit these proteins for signaling.

The second pain stage is due to an inflammatory reaction, while the main reaction is acute injuries to your nerve fibers. Conolidine injection was uncovered to suppress the two the stage one and a couple of pain response (60). This implies conolidine correctly suppresses both of those chemically or inflammatory pain of both equally an acute and persistent nature. More evaluation by Tarselli et al. identified conolidine to get no affinity for the mu-opioid receptor, suggesting another method of motion from regular opiate analgesics. Additionally, this research revealed the drug would not alter locomotor action in mice topics, suggesting a lack of Unwanted effects like sedation or dependancy found in other dopamine-selling substances (60).
